Subject: Re: [pve-devel] [PATCH manager] GUI: Ceph wizard: autoselect current node

Am 5/5/22 um 16:27 schrieb Matthias Heiserer:
> One step of installing ceph is creating a monitor. When installing via
> the datacenter and from a node other than the first node, clicking "next"
> without changing the monitor node could result in the error
> 'binary not installed: /usr/bin/ceph-mon', as it would try to install
> the monitor on the first node, although ceph was installed on the current
> node.
>
> With this patch, the current node is preselected.
> This has no effect when installing ceph on a specific node, as the node
> selector overwrites the preferred value in that case.
>
> Signed-off-by: Matthias Heiserer <m.heiserer@proxmox.com>
> ---
> www/manager6/ceph/CephInstallWizard.js | 1 +
> 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)
>
> diff --git a/www/manager6/ceph/CephInstallWizard.js b/www/manager6/ceph/CephInstallWizard.js
> index 59458b0d..ebdc7f1d 100644
> --- a/www/manager6/ceph/CephInstallWizard.js
> +++ b/www/manager6/ceph/CephInstallWizard.js
> @@ -403,6 +403,7 @@ Ext.define('PVE.ceph.CephInstallWizard', {
> name: 'mon-node',
> selectCurNode: true,
> allowBlank: false,
> + preferredValue: Proxmox.NodeName,
That is always the local node one is connected through the web interface.
So, what if I'm connected through Node A but currently installing/initializing ceph on Node B?
Should this rather be the node currently selected in the resource tree?
